National PTA’s commitment to the health and welfare of all children and youth is the basis for its long-time support of alcohol, drug, and other substance abuse education, treatment, and prevention efforts.

The solution to the problem of alcohol and drug abuse requires a sustained and collaborative effort on the part of agencies and organizations at the federal, state, and local levels. National PTA believes in strong efforts to prevent substance abuse.

National PTA reaffirms its support for:

  • Comprehensive prevention and treatment programs that provide current and accurate information on all aspects of alcohol, tobacco, and substance abuse, including illegal and over-the-counter drugs, herbs, and performance-enhancing substances and supplements;
  • Prevention programs that have an appropriate parent involvement component;
  • Recreational and educational programs that offer alternatives to help prevent substance abuse among children and youth;
  • Inclusion of substance abuse education in comprehensive school health programs;
  • PTA/PTSA education programs and advocacy efforts that address "look-alike" drugs, which are deliberately manufactured to resemble dangerous controlled substances;
  • Responsible advertising of alcohol, prescription, and non-prescription substances.

This position statement was written to update and combine resolutions and position statements concerning “Substance Abuse Prevention and Treatment”. The original resolutions and position statements will be archived in the Historical Records as reference on this issue.
